Cawemo Enterprise (On-Premises) 1.6 Released

We’re happy to announce the 1.6 release of Cawemo Enterprise On-Premises. Cawemo is the specification platform of the Camunda stack, enabling all stakeholders to model and collaborate on BPMN and DMN diagrams and related files. The main improvements in this release are: DMN Modeling Cawemo supports modeling of DMN diagrams in addition to BPMN. Enhanced Template Editor In addition to UiPath, Cawemo supports templates for Automation Anywhere and External Service Tasks. Additionally, you are able to define BPMN Errors. Improved Access Rights Capabilities Organizations and projects can have more than one admin now. LDAP integration You can connect your on-premises installation to an LDAP server. Spring Boot Starter for the External Task Client

We are happy to announce that Camunda Platform Runtime 7.15 will provide a Spring Boot Starter for the External Task Client. It allows you to implement Service Tasks decoupled from the Process Engine using Spring Boot. In seconds, you can build an executable JAR that can run almost anywhere. In 2018, Camunda released the first version of the External Task Client. Since then, our community member Oliver Steinhauer developed a Starter that combines the External Task Client with Spring Boot. With the 7.15 release, we will add the former Community Extension to the official Camunda Stack and will maintain it as part of future product releases.
